Unpacking Regulatory Shifts and‌ Industry News That Will Reshape Supply​ Chains and ​Pricing

The regulatory terrain around cannabinoids is shifting like tectonic ‍plates – slow, unavoidable and capable of rearranging entire coastlines of commerce. Recent moves by states ‌to clarify ⁢how THCa is⁢ classified⁤ and ‌tested are forcing⁣ processors and labs to rewrite SOPs, ⁤while federal​ discussions about broader hemp definitions hint at larger puzzles ahead.Compliance is no longer a ‌checkbox; it’s a structural cost that touches cultivation practices, extraction protocols⁤ and the​ packaging line. Companies ⁣that fail to embed regulatory intelligence into thier procurement and pricing strategies risk sudden ‍margin erosion.

Several headline developments and rule ‌changes are‍ already shaping supply ⁢dynamics​ and ⁣cost curves.⁣ Watch for:

Change Likely‍ impact Timing
Potency‌ caps Supply re-sorting; premium for ⁤compliant genetics 6-12 months
Standardized lab protocols Higher per-unit compliance cost; ​quality ​differentiation 3-9 months
Banking​ access reforms Investment inflows; scale-up acceleration 1-2 years

Those shifts translate‍ directly into pricing behavior: some⁢ producers ​will see squeezed ​margins and resort to discounting,‍ while⁢ vertically integrated​ operators with in-house labs ⁢and contracted genetics can protect or even expand margins⁢ through supply resilience. Expect episodic⁢ price volatility as inventories ‌are rebalanced and‌ buyers ‌renegotiate contracts to build regulatory ‍buffers.⁣ Strategic responses-contract farming, forward-price contracting, investment in compliance automation-won’t eliminate‍ risk but will determine‍ who captures the⁣ next wave of ⁤value as the market’s legal contours firm ⁣up.
